Released October 6th, 2018, 'Flight of the Conchords Live in London' stars Jemaine Clement, Bret McKenzie, Nigel Collins The mov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 28 min, and received a user score of 76 (out of 100) on TMDb, which put together reviews from 28 knowledgeable users.
You probably already know what the movie's about, but just in case... Here's the plot: "New Zealands 4th Most Popular Parody Duo are back for a muthauckin special concert live at the London Apollo" .
